多個數據庫 配置: 寫入到 指定數據庫 使用 讀寫分離 手動 自動 settings中配置 DATABASE_ROUTERS = ['myrouter.Router'] 一主多從 分庫分表 執行原生sql ...
一 讀寫分離 因為用戶的增多,數據的增多,單機的數據庫往往支撐不住快速發展的業務,所以數據庫集群就產生了 讀寫分離顧名思義就是讀和寫分離了,對應到數據庫集群一般都是一主一從 一個主庫,一個從庫 或者一主多從 一個主庫,多個從庫 ,業務服務器把需要寫的操作都寫到主數據庫中,讀的操作都去從庫查詢。主庫會同步數據到從庫保證數據的一致性。 這種集群方式的本質就是把訪問的壓力從主庫轉移到從庫,適合讀的請求較 ...
2020-03-22 14:18 0 2530 推薦指數:
多個數據庫 配置: 寫入到 指定數據庫 使用 讀寫分離 手動 自動 settings中配置 DATABASE_ROUTERS = ['myrouter.Router'] 一主多從 分庫分表 執行原生sql ...
讀寫分離,基本的原理是讓主數據庫處理事務性增、改、刪操作(INSERT、UPDATE、DELETE),而從數據庫處理SELECT查詢操作。數據庫復制被用來把事務性操作導致的變更同步到集群中的從數據庫。 為什么要分庫、分表、讀寫分? 單表的數據 ...
Mycat是一個開源的分布式數據庫系統,不同於oracle和mysql,Mycat並沒有存儲引擎,但是Mycat實現了mysql協議,前段用戶可以把它當做一個Proxy。其核心功能是分表分庫,即將一個大表水平分割為N個小表,存儲在后端mysql存儲引擎里面。最新版本的Mycat不僅支持mysql ...
讀寫分離:主庫負責增刪改查,從庫負責查詢, 需要注意的是,從庫任何增刪改不會影響到主庫 事務復制: 准備工作: l 環境:Microsoft SQL Server 2014版本 l 開啟服務:Sql Server服務、SqlServer代理服務 l 數據庫:生成數據庫 ...
系統開發中,數據庫是非常重要的一個點。除了程序的本身的優化,如:SQL語句優化、代碼優化,數據庫的處理本身優化也是非常重要的。主從、熱備、分表分庫等都是系統發展遲早會遇到的技術問題問題。Mycat是一個廣受好評的數據庫中間件,已經在很多產品上進行使用了。希望通過這篇文章的介紹,能學會 ...
為什么要分庫分表和讀寫分離? 類似淘寶網這樣的網站,海量數據的存儲和訪問成為了系統設計的瓶頸問題,日益增長的業務數據,無疑對數據庫造成了相當大的負載,同時對於系統的穩定性和擴展性提出很高的要求。隨着時間和業務的發展,數據庫中的表會越來越多,表中的數據量也會越來越大,相應地,數據操作的開銷 ...
轉: https://www.cnblogs.com/joylee/p/7513038.html 學會數據庫讀寫分離、分表分庫——用Mycat,這一篇就夠了! 系統開發中,數據庫是非常重要的一個點。除了程序的本身的優化,如:SQL語句優化、代碼優化,數據庫 ...
1.分表 當項目上線后,數據將會幾何級的增長,當數據很多的時候,讀取性能將會下降,更新表數據的時候也需要更新索引,所以我們需要分表,當數據量再大的時候就需要分庫了。 a.水平拆分:數據分成多個表 b.垂直拆分:字段分成多個表 c.插入/更新/刪除數據和查詢統計 MyISAM存儲引擎 ...